Drug and Alcohol Detox Withdrawal Symptoms

Research on drug and/or alcohol withdrawal shows that when you suddenly stop using different drugs and/or alcohol, you may experience various symptoms; these symptoms - as well as their intensity - will vary from patient to patient.

Some things that could potentially influence your withdrawal experience as you undergo detox include:

The length of your addiction and the frequency of your substance abuse could affect how severe your withdrawal symptoms are.

The combination of substances you misused; in many cases, you will find that those addicted to more than one substance might experience unique withdrawal with a constellation of unusual symptoms because one substance could exacerbate the other.

The amount of drugs or alcohol you used to abuse when you enrolled in the detox center in Gardendale, Texas. Many people experience tolerance after abusing drugs for a long time; basically, they may have to increase their usual dose incrementally to feel the effects that they desire. Unfortunately, these higher amounts used might mean that your withdrawal could be more severe when you decide to stop using.

The existence of any co-occurring mental and physical health disorders; patients suffering from mental health issues like anxiety or physical issues such as insomnia and chronic pain might have more intense withdrawal symptoms and significant distress.

The half life of the drugs; drugs with a short half life trigger more immediate withdrawal symptoms whereas substances that are longer acting might cause your withdrawal syndrome to be delayed for several hours or days.

Recent studies on addiction rehab show that when you undergo detox, you may develop any of the following withdrawal symptoms:

  • Agitation
  • Chills
  • Cravings
  • Flu-like symptoms, which could include vomiting, nausea, headache, and runny nose
  • Irritability
  • Mood swings
  • Shaking
  • Sleep disturbances and insomnia
  • Sweating
  • Tremors

The Veterans Administration is America's largest integrated health care system, providing care at 1,243 health care facilities, including 172 medical centers and 1,062 outpatient sites of care of varying complexity (VHA outpatient clinics), serving 9 million enrolled Veterans each year. VA provides a continuum of forward-looking outpatient, residential, and inpatient mental health services across the country. Points of access to care span VA medical centers, Community Based Outpatient Clinics, Vet Centers, and mobile Vet Centers. VA offers mental health & substance abuse treatments in a variety of settings, including: Short-term, inpatient care; Outpatient care in a psychosocial rehabilitation and recovery centers (PRRC); Regular outpatient care, which may include telemedicine services; Residential Rehabilitation Treatment Programs (RRTP); Primary care; Residential care; and Supported work settings.
